Ingredients You’ll Need
For this homemade sponge cake recipe in minutes, gather the following:
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up granulated sugar
4 large eggs (room temperature)
½ cup unsalted butter (melted and cooled)
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 teaspoon baking powder
¼ teaspoon salt
2 tablespoons milk
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Preheat & Prepare
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Grease and line an 8-inch round cake pan with parchment paper.
Step 2: Beat the Eggs &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, beat the eggs and sugar with an electric mixer for 5–7 minutes until pale, thick, and doubled in volume.
This step is crucial for a light sponge.
Step 3: Add Vanilla & Butter
Gently mix in vanilla extract and melted butter.
Be careful not to deflate the airy mixture.
Step 4: Fold in Dry Ingredients
Sift together flour, baking powder, and salt.
Gradually fold into the egg mixture using a spatula.
Add milk to loosen the batter if needed.
Step 5: Bake
Pour batter into the prepared pan.
Bake for 25–30 minutes or until golden and springy to the touch.
Test with a toothpick—if it comes out clean, your sponge cake is ready!
Step 6: Cool & Serve
Let cake c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ack.
Serve plain, dusted with powdered sugar, or layered with cream and fruit.
Variations to Try 🎂
Lemon Sponge Cake – Add 1 tablespoon lemon zest to the batter.
Chocolate Sponge Cake – Replace ¼ cup flour with cocoa powder.
Victoria Sponge – Slice in half and fill with jam and whipped cream.
Coffee Sponge – Add 2 teaspoons instant coffee to warm milk before mixing.
Practical Tips for the Perfect Sponge Cake 💡
Room Temperature Eggs – Help achieve maximum volume.
Don’t Overmix – Fold gently to keep the batter airy.
Even Baking – Rotate the pan halfway through for consistent results.
Storage – Keep in an airtight container at room temperature for 2–3 days.
